Fraternal Order of Eagles (EIN: 91-0226495) has filed an IRS Form 990 since fiscal year 2021. In its fiscal year 2025 IRS Form 990 filing, Fraternal Order of Eagles, a 501(c)(8) fraternal beneficiary society, reported compensation for 14 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$12,374. The highest compensated employee at Fraternal Order of Eagles is Marvin Trepus with fiscal year 2025 compensation of $14,351.

Mission Statement

THE FRATERNAL ORDER OF EAGLES AN INTERNATIONAL ORGANIZATION UNITES FRATERNALLY IN THE SPIRIT OF LIBERTY TRUTH JUSTICE AND EQUALITY TO MAKE HUMAN LIFE MORE DESIRABLE BY LESSENING ITS ILLS AND BY PROMOTING PEACE PROSPERITY GLADNESS AND HOPE.
